Output 44665d8a840658bf86bc412c59a47bb05b24d8c9a6ec033169223b749e495d71:1

value
143595635
script pubkey
OP_0 OP_PUSHBYTES_20 efd39fccc774a7c4a10122ec9c79f794263ae09c
address
ltc1qalfelnx8wjnufggpytkfc70hjsnr4cyul5gyns
transaction
44665d8a840658bf86bc412c59a47bb05b24d8c9a6ec033169223b749e495d71
spent
true